Job Description

Join Nexus Quantum Labs at the forefront of computational revolution. As a Quantum Computing Research Scientist, you'll architect breakthrough algorithms and protocols that will define the technological landscape of 2026 and beyond. Our interdisciplinary team pioneers quantum-resistant cryptography, quantum machine learning, and scalable quantum error correction in a state-of-the-art facility overlooking the Bay. We offer competitive equity packages, flexible work arrangements, and dedicated R&D budgets for your most ambitious projects.

Responsibilities

  • Design and implement novel quantum algorithms for optimization and simulation problems
  • Lead research in quantum error correction and fault-tolerant architectures
  • Collaborate with hardware teams to translate theoretical models into practical implementations
  • Publish findings in top-tier journals and present at international conferences
  • Mentor junior researchers and drive cross-functional innovation initiatives
  • Secure external funding through NSF and DARPA grant applications

Qualifications

  • PhD in Physics, Computer Science, or related field with 3+ years postdoctoral experience
  • Published research in quantum computing or quantum information theory
  • Proficiency in quantum programming frameworks (Qiskit, Cirq, or Q#)
  • Expertise in linear algebra, probability theory, and complexity analysis
  • Strong track record of securing research grants or patents
  • Experience with superconducting or photonic quantum hardware
